abstract = {In a Compact Accelerator based Neutron Source (CANS) the
irradiation of the target material with protons (or
deuterons) and neutrons induced radioisotopes which
activities must be considered during and after operation of
the target for radiation safety issues. The activity
produced by irradiation of a tantalum target with 70 MeV
protons is presented together with the concept of the
radiation shielding of the neutron source.},
